Mold can be a homeowner’s nightmare, silently spreading through your home and potentially causing health issues. Knowing when to call in a professional for a mold inspection is crucial.

Here’s a guide to help you identify the telltale signs that you may need expert help.

Visible Mold Growth

It may look like spots of black, green, or other colors on the walls, ceilings, or even under sinks. You might also notice it on tiles in the bathroom.

This mold can spread quickly if it is not cleaned up. When you see mold, it can be a sign of a bigger moisture problem. It’s a good idea to call a mold inspector who can help check your home. A mold inspector knows how to find the source of the mold and can tell you what steps to take next. Keeping your home clean and dry is key to stopping mold from coming back.

Musty Odor

If you notice a musty smell, it’s important not to ignore it, as it can mean there is too much moisture in the air. High moisture can lead to more mold growth, which can be harmful to your health and your home.

Allergic Symptoms

You might sneeze a lot, have a runny or stuffy nose, or feel your eyes getting itchy and red. Some people also start coughing or have a sore throat. These issues can get worse if you’re around mold for a long time.

If you or someone in your home is feeling sick often, it might be a good idea to check for home mold detection. Mold can affect your health, especially if you have asthma or other breathing problems. Keeping your home clean and dry can help stop these symptoms from coming back.

Water Damage or Leaks

Water damage or leaks can be a big problem in your home. If you see water spots on the ceiling or walls, it might mean there is a leak. Sometimes, you might find wet spots on the floor or carpet, too.

Leaks can come from pipes, the roof, or even from windows when it rains a lot. If you find water in places where it should not be, it is important to fix it quickly. Water damage can lead to mold, which is not good for your health.

Previous Mold Issues

Make sure to check areas that have had mold before, like the attic, basement, or bathroom, to see if mold is growing again. Regular cleaning and keeping rooms dry can help stop mold from coming back.

Also, think about using a dehumidifier to lower the moisture in the air, especially if you live in a humid area. Keeping these areas dry and clean can make a big difference and help keep mold away for good.
